A risk rating helps a company in deciding how and … WebNov 2, 2024 · EMIs classify all business activities as low-risk, high-risk, and prohibited. High-risk activities require more scrutiny, EMIs can request additional documentation, confirming source of funding, business relationships with clients and suppliers, company's operational address.

Webkeeping notes of your decisions, particularly on cases which seem to pose a higher risk Corporate bodies Where your client is a corporate body, you must obtain and verify: its name its company number or other registration the address of its registered office and, if different, its principal place of business
